Code B222A Toyota Description
This Diagnostic Trouble Code (DTC) is output when the Multiplex Network Door ECU detects a Power Back Door (PBD) Sensor Assembly set Left (LH) Touch Sensor malfunction.
What are the Possible Causes of the DTC B222A Toyota?
- Faulty Power Back Door (PBD) Sensor Assembly Left (LH)
- Power Back Door Sensor Assembly Left harness is open or shorted
- Power Back Door Sensor Assembly Left circuit poor electrical connection
- Faulty Multiplex Network Door ECU
How to Fix the DTC B222A Toyota?
Review the 'Possible Causes' above and visually examine the corresponding wiring harness and connectors. Check for damaged components and inspect connector pins for signs of being broken, bent, pushed out, or corroded.
What is the Cost to Diagnose the Code?
Labor: 1.0
To diagnose the B222A Toyota code, it typically requires 1.0 hour of labor. Rates vary by location, vehicle, and shop. Many shops charge between $80β$150 per hour; dealerships and metro areas may be higher, independents may be lower.
